Transaction ec46057663a012039fb1a809c2650332b3815b216636059066696b44b55ee304
1 Input
1 Output
-
ec46057663a012039fb1a809c2650332b3815b216636059066696b44b55ee304:0
- value
- 738763
- script pubkey
- OP_0 OP_PUSHBYTES_20 f16dab841471f7336814ba0cbc98a775d665041f
- address
- bc1q79k6hpq5w8mnx6q5hgxtex98whtx2pqluxyh26